python 调度程序

标签 python threadpool scheduler

我正在Python中寻找一个调度程序,它将同时启动一系列线程(正好是8个),当其中一个线程完成时,它将向作业池添加一个新线程,并启动它。此过程将继续,直到所有线程(~100)完成。

我查看了 APScheduler 包。也许通过使用 add_job,我也许能够做到这一点,尽管还不清楚,因为我找不到任何示例。

add_job(trigger, func, args, kwargs, jobstore='default', **options)

有谁知道如何在此函数中设置触发器

最佳答案

这个问题的答案是使用并发 future

http://docs.python.org/dev/library/concurrent.futures.html

关于 python 调度程序,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13132521/

相关文章:

python selenium firefox - add_extension 不起作用

scheduler - 如何使用 hapi-fhir Java API 安排调查问卷?

python - 将 Spyder 设置为默认 Python

python - 如何使 Reportlab PDF 具有交互性?

python - 如何在 Python 中获取字符的位置?

.net - 我在哪里可以找到 ThreadPool.SwitchTo 方法?

C# 是否可以中断 ThreadPool 中的特定线程?

java - 线程在 ThreadPoolExecutor 中等待

java - 是否可以以声明方式配置非全局监听器?

c++ - 获取线程中的最小大小